Questions:
Regard as two charged particles at a separation of 4 cm. Particle #1 has a charge of +2 micro-coulombs. Particle #2 has a charge of +16 micro-coulombs. How does the magnitude of the force bring to bear on particle #1 beside particle #2 evaluate with the magnitude of the force exerted on particle #2 by particle #1?
Answer:
By Newton's 3rd Law the force that one particle make use of on another particle is equal in magnitude and opposite in direction to the force that the second particle exerts on the first particle. There is no approach around Newton's 3rd law. A particle cannot be pushing on another particle with no that second particle pushing back just as hard. There are no exemptions!
